In this video, I visited Carlton Music Center in Winter Haven, FL and we tuned a set of Stingray Quint Tenors that are very old, but in great condition. The drum heads on these tenors have been played on by students for several years. This is my first time tuning a set of Stingray or even Tenors, so I had to take some time to get to know the drums. After a few minutes, I get to tuning and I'm mostly aiming for the fundamental pitch by getting the lugs evened out. Also take notice that there's a strike pad surface on these drums, so that's going to slightly affect the tuning. I just compensated for this by tuning those a little higher than the lugs that did not have the white surface.
